Clarifying Responsibilities: The Distinct Jobs of a listing agent and a buyers agent
Within the real estate field, professionals often concentrate in representing either vendors or buyers. Knowing the separation between a listing agent and a buyers agent is crucial for a successful transaction. Each type of real estate agent perform a unique and critical part in the transaction. Below are several key distinctions:
- A listing agent primarily works for the vendor, striving to market the property effectively and achieve the most favorable price and terms.
- Conversely, a buyers agent exclusively works with the purchaser, guiding them to find a appropriate property and negotiate its purchase.}
- The listing agent manages responsibilities like pricing strategy, creating promotional content, conducting viewings, and discussing terms on behalf of the client.
- A buyers agent delivers buyers with information on properties on the market, arranges property viewings, helps with bidding tactics, and supports with inspections.
- Both the listing agent and the buyers agent usually compensated through a fee that is covered from the transaction funds at closing, though specific arrangements can vary.
Essentially, both types of realtor strive hard to ensure a successful real estate transaction for their particular clients. Opting for the right type of real estate agent hinges on whether you are selling or purchasing property.

Selecting Your Partner: Essential Tips for Hiring a real estate agent
Selecting the ideal real estate agent is a fundamental step in your real estate endeavor. Your chosen agent will be your guide, so it's essential to choose a professional who understands your needs and you can trust. Evaluate their experience, particularly with properties similar to yours in your neighborhood. A knowledgeable realtor should possess in-depth understanding of current market dynamics and strong bargaining skills. Feel free to request testimonials from past clients to gauge their professionalism. Additionally, ensure they are properly licensed and belong to professional real estate organizations, which often indicates adherence to a strict code of ethics, whether they are a listing agent or a buyers agent. Finally, a good real estate agent will communicate effectively, be initiative-taking, and work tirelessly to deliver the desired results.

Frequently Asked Questions about working with a realtor
- Q: What are the key factors to consider when selecting a real estate company?
A: When picking a real estate company, look for their reputation in the market, knowledge of the area, the range of services available (like support for both a listing agent and a buyers agent), and reviews from past clients. It's also important their agents hold the proper credentials, experienced, and compatible with your communication style.
